Pre-Production: Laying the Foundation for Success

Pre-production for a Who Wants to Be a Millionaire? Celebrity Special is a marathon, not a sprint. It involves meticulous planning and coordination across numerous departments to ensure a flawless execution on filming day.

Celebrity Selection and Contract Negotiations

The process of selecting celebrities for the Millionaire Celebrity Edition is a delicate balancing act. The production team seeks individuals who possess:

  • High public recognition: Celebrities with broad appeal attract a larger viewership.
  • A solid knowledge base: The questions are challenging, so contestants need a broad range of general knowledge.
  • A compelling on-screen presence: Their personality needs to translate well to television.

Negotiating contracts involves intricate legal processes and managing the often-complex expectations of celebrity talent. This phase requires skilled negotiators who can balance the needs of the production company with those of the celebrities. Question Development and Research

Crafting the perfect questions for a Millionaire Celebrity Special is a highly specialized skill. A dedicated team of researchers spends countless hours:

  • Developing questions: They brainstorm questions across a vast range of topics, ensuring a balance of difficulty and entertainment value.
  • Fact-checking and verifying: Rigorous fact-checking is crucial to maintain the integrity of the show and avoid errors. Research and Development for the quiz questions is a critical component of Millionaire Quiz Questions.

The aim is to create Millionaire Quiz Questions that are challenging enough to test the celebrities' knowledge but not so difficult as to make the show frustrating to watch.

Editing and Sound Mixing

Video Editing and Sound Mixing are crucial steps in the post-production process. This involves:

  • Assembling the show: Arranging the segments into a cohesive narrative.
  • Fine-tuning audio: Ensuring clarity, balance, and optimal sound quality.
  • Music and sound effects: Adding music and sound effects to enhance the atmosphere and emotional impact.

Graphics and Visual Effects

Adding Graphics and Visual Effects enhances the viewing experience and contributes to the overall entertainment value. This includes:

  • On-screen graphics: Displays of scores, lifelines, and other important information.
  • Visual enhancements: Adding visual elements to emphasize key moments and improve the overall aesthetic appeal.
